The opening keynote was all about the FB Apocalypse. I haven’t talked much about this because there’s some really good info out there that goes in depth.

Opening Keynote - Social Media Marketing in 2018: What the Newest Research Reveals By Michael Stelzner, Social Media Examiner

  1. FB pages are getting less traffic and attention
  2. They’re prioritizing content posted by friends/family over a business page - in fact, business pages will see a dramatic decrease in being in the news feed
  3. Signals like reactions, comments, and shares. Long comments are more important than short comments

Use Video to gain traction on Facebook

  • Do a breaking news show, ask for feedback from the audience
  • Go live at events
  • Weekly tool/tip
  • Talk strategy
  • FB live
  • Use Vertical video (for ads too)
  • Get personal. It's all about connections

Creative marketing strategies to promote your online course

  1. Find a local community college or technical school to offer your courses. They get a percentage of the sales.
  2. Approach companies that have a similar, parallel or matching audience and offer a referral program
  3. Create white label courses where you create the content and then resell it to others who offer it to their audience
  4. Put a promo link in your email signature
